This spider is sometimes mistaken for the brown recluse spider, though there is only a vague resemblance between the two. Yet, like the brown recluse, the woodlouse spider has six eyes and is most active at night. This spider has a ½-inch long body. Cellar Spiders are probably some of the most common types of spiders found in your house that has long legs. Brown Cellar Spiders are often found in basements (hence the “cellar” in their name), and although are typically brown, can also be light yellow or gray. These spiders are quite harmless to humans, and it is rare for them to bite. 1. Yellow Garden Spider. New Zealand has about 1,100 named natiSpiders, along with daddy long legs, ticks, mites Features: Crab spiders are low and flat and their front two pairs of legs are very long. Crab spiders are not web builders. Notes: Crab spiders are very common in Kentucky flowers (where they hunt for bees), but they sometimes wander into homes. Because some crab spiders are brown in color, they are occasionally mistaken for brown recluses.
